Rear-End Compatibility 700 1988

I've finally got my new front bushings and front brakes done so I'm ready to move on to my next project. I want to swap out my noisy, slow 3.31 rear end with a shorter ratio out of an automatic turbo or n/a 700 series(3.73 or 3.91). What years will I be able to swap with? If I remember correctly the earlier models were a little different. Can I use the rear end from a car with ABS? My car doesn't have ABS. Lastly can I grab the instrument cluster from the car I take the rear end from so the speedometer is already calibrated to that final drive ratio?(I can change the mileage to have it match mine)
-E. Reid
'88 744 gle, m47II, non-ABS, 3.31
